FOCUS ZOOM ᕣ Part Names of the Projector Front/Top Zoom Lever (VT695/VT595/VT590/VT490/VT59) Digital Zoom Button (VT49) (→ page 24) Remote sensor (→ page 8) Focus Ring (→ page 24) Lens FOCUS ZOOM MENU SELECT EXIT AUTO ADJ. ENTER SOURCE POWESRTATULSAMP ON/STAND BY 1. Introduction Controls (→ page 5) Ventilation (inlet) / Filter Cover (→ page 50) Two filters on VT695, VT595, VT590 and VT490 One filter on VT59 and VT49 Built-in Security Slot ( )* Lens Cap * This security slot supports the MicroSaver ® Security System. MicroSaver ® is a registered trademark of Kensington Microware Inc. The logo is trademarked and owned by Kensington Microware Inc. Rear Terminal Panel (→ page 6) Monaural Speaker (VT695/VT595: 5W) (VT590/VT490/VT59/VT49: 1W) POWERSTATUSLAMP ON/STAND BY SOURCE AUTO ADJ. ENTER SELECT EXIT MENU ZOOM FOCUS Remote sensor (VT695 and VT595 only) (→ page 8) Ventilation (outlet) Heated air is exhausted from here. AC Input Connect the supplied power cable's two-pin plug here, and plug the other end into an active wall outlet. (→ page 19) Main Power Switch When you plug the supplied power cable into an active wall outlet and turn on the Main Power, the POWER indicator turns orange and the projector is in standby mode.
